Frage

will ein Client eine Blackberry-Anwendung für Live-Radio für seinen Radio-Sender hören. Wir konzentrierten uns auf iPhone Entwicklung. Ich weiß, dass Java-Sprache mehrere Projekte getan haben. Allerdings habe nicht versucht, noch J2ME. Und ihr tut J2ME oder HTML Javascript Frameworks wie PhoneGap oder andere Cross-Plattform-Framework empfehlen? Was sind die Vor- und Nachteile von ihnen? Vielen Dank.

War es hilfreich?

Lösung

Wenn Sie mit Java Swing oder anderem Java-UI sind komfortabel programmiert dann mit nativem gehen ist wahrscheinlich eine gute Idee.

Wenn Sie sich wohler mit HTML, JavaScript und CSS sind dann PhoneGap verwenden. Wenn Sie auf die Bereitstellung der Anwendung auf mehr als eine Plattform planen, dann auf jeden Fall PhoneGap verwenden. PhoneGap können Sie auch die native Blackberry Java-Code schreiben und integrieren, dass mit der HTML / JS-Code, falls die spezifischen APIs Sie brauchen, sind nicht ausgesetzt.

Mit der bevorstehenden Veröffentlichung von Blackberry OS 6 Dinge sollten besser eine Menge erhalten auf dieser Plattform sowohl für PhoneGap (da der Browser nun WebKit basiert) und für native Java-Programmierung.

Es gibt viele andere Vergleiche zwischen PhoneGap und X auf Stackoverflow, obwohl die meisten anderen Cross-Plattform-Frameworks nicht unterstützen Blackberry.

Andere Tipps

  • J2ME: Blackberry unterstützt dies (und ist tatsächlich immer noch der Kern des BB), aber es ist eine schnell alternde Plattform. Sie können nicht ohne die proprietäre APIs viele interessante Dinge in BB tun.
  • Phonegap: Habe es selbst nicht verwendet, aber ich habe so lala Dinge über sie gehört. Hohe Fußabdruck, den kleinsten gemeinsamen Nenner etc.
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top